Transaction f620d970f8bee30a73896675b7825d28b42342f3b3a60a02c8a2c539bc13391a

1 Input
1 Outputs
  • f620d970f8bee30a73896675b7825d28b42342f3b3a60a02c8a2c539bc13391a:0
  • value  1082511
    address  3KFbJqcZFxmcdCBoCVci7w48F3XXZNEmWA